Context: The BNPL Giant’s Pivot
Klarna, the Swedish buy-now-pay-later behemoth, has dominated the consumer credit space for years. Now it’s pushing into broader banking, aiming to offer deposit accounts, payments, and lending under one roof. The logic is textbook: replace expensive wholesale funding with cheap retail deposits. But the execution is a minefield. Core: The Hidden Cost of Becoming a Bank
Let’s dissect the numbers. The Q2 profit likely came from three sources: cost-cutting (AI replacing human labor, which I flagged in my 2021 Axie Infinity analysis as a double-edged sword), higher interest income from floating-rate BNPL loans, and potentially one-time gains from asset sales. Strip those away, and the organic earnings power is thin. The real story is the balance sheet transformation.
Klarna’s BNPL portfolio is unsecured consumer credit, highly sensitive to a recession. To become a bank, it must meet liquidity coverage ratios (LCR) and net stable funding ratios (NSFR). That means holding high-quality liquid assets—an expensive drag on returns. Its AI-driven risk models, built for instant credit decisions, now need to pass regulatory scrutiny for explainability. Moreover, the funding structure is fragile. Klarna currently relies on capital markets and asset-backed securities for funding. The transition to deposits will take years. During that period, any credit cycle downturn could spike defaults. The Q2 profit may already be absorbing lower provisioning, which is a classic sign of balance sheet smoothing. Contrarian: The Mirage of the Banking Premium
The market is betting that Klarna’s banking pivot will unlock a new growth vector. But the contrarian view is that Klarna is walking into a trap. Traditional banks have decades of deposit relationships and low-cost funding. Klarna’s core users—millennials and Gen Z—are low-balance, high-churn. They use Klarna for shopping, not saving. Converting them to primary banking customers is a long shot. Meanwhile, big tech (Apple, Google) is entering BNPL with terminal-level control. Apple Pay Later is not a feature; it’s a defensive move that will cannibalize Klarna’s merchant relationships.

And then there’s the regulatory angle. The European Union is tightening the screws on BNPL, forcing Klarna to become a bank just to stay in the game. The profit is not a signal of strength; it’s a survival mechanism. The real question is whether Klarna can sustain its margins while absorbing the costs of a full banking license.
